Q: Is 2,464,217 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,464,217 is a composite number.

Why is 2,464,217 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,464,217 can be evenly divided by 1 7 29 61 199 203 427 1,393 1,769 5,771 12,139 12,383 40,397 84,973 352,031 and 2,464,217, with no remainder.

Since 2,464,217 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,464,217, it is a composite number.
